内容記述 | Mechanism rotates and translates instrument platform within pressure housing in aircraft to aim remote-sensing instrument toward target on ground below. Enables instrument to look under aircraft structure at larger fore and aft angles without having to deploy instrument into air stream outside. Also provides 10 degrees of yaw compensation, reducing further need for adjustment of attitude of aircraft to keep target in sight. With yaw compensation, pilot can fly with wings level and nose pointed into crosswind while on desired flight path over target. |
